MINISTRY of Health Permanent Secretary, Malcolm Watkins, on Tuesday, sign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) with the Central Islamic Organisation of Guyana (CIOG) for the management and operation of the New Amsterdam Funeral Parlour, East Berbice-Corentyne.
During his remarks, Health Minister, Dr. Frank Anthony, welcomed the initiative and said that the ministry is grateful for the partnership and collaboration with the CIOG.
“We know the hardship that people were experiencing in Region Five and Six and therefore this is a very timely intervention. We value this partnership and by combining our efforts we will be able to reach people and provide services,” Minister Anthony said.
Also present at the signing ceremony held at the Ministry of Health, Brickdam Headquarters, were Deputy President, Goolzar Namdar; Director of Education and Dawah, Moeenul Hack and CIOG General Manager, Shameena Haniff.
